Two seekers after truth went to a Master to be put on the way. What did he do? He gave them two pigeons and told them, “Go to some place where nobody will see you and kill them.” One man went out behind a wall, killed the pigeon and came back: “Master, I’ve killed it. There was nobody there.” The other poor fellow was hunting, knocking about from place to place, in many secret places, many lonely places, from morn to night. He could not find any place where nobody was seeing him. He came back: “Master, I’m helpless. I could not find any place where nobody was seeing me.” – “Who was it?” He said, “The very pigeon was seeing me.” When he went to kill, it looked at him. It was God in him. Just think. These are very simple things, but they are pregnant with meaning.

God resides in every heart. He also resides in you. He is watching our every action. Similarly, God in man, the Master, also looks to our shortcomings, but he does so lovingly. He wants to wash them away. So always remain in his presence. That is why Kabir said, “When the Master initiates you (Master is not the body; it is the Godpower working in him), he resides with you forever.” One thing: He is always present. Can you do any sin, tell lies, deceive others, act or pose? No.
